Daniel Rutledge reviews John Wick: Chapter 2

John Wick: Chapter 2 is superb.

The sequel to the cult classic ups the ante and doubles down on what makes these films so great - unbelievably thrilling action executed by virtuoso choreographers with a perfect blend of stunts and special effects.

Every gunshot, every punch, every hit is conceived and performed to deliver maximum impact possible upon the audience and to provide maximum entertainment.

Several of those thrilling impacts are then sewn together into extended sequences that are rhythmically calculated masterfully and end up as glorious symphonies of violence.

The comic book style mythology of the assassin world established in the first film is expanded upon in the sequel, somewhat to its discredit. I think as a whole package, the original is better - but Chapter 2 is greater where it counts most, in the action itself.

If you're a fan of real, un-watered down action cinema, they don't come better than this.

Five stars.
